What Is Facebook Dating’s Secret Crush Feature?
The Secret Crush feature was introduced by Meta Platforms as part of Facebook’s dating ecosystem.
The concept is simple but powerful.
Instead of matching with strangers, you can select people you already know and quietly mark them as a “crush.”
Here is how it works.
You can add up to nine people from:
-
Your Facebook friends list
-
Your Instagram followers (if linked)
If one of those people also adds you to their Secret Crush list, both of you will receive a notification revealing the match.
If they do not select you, they never know you chose them.
This makes the feature safer and less awkward than openly confessing romantic interest.
Why Facebook Created the Secret Crush Feature
Traditional dating apps often focus on meeting strangers.
But Facebook recognized something interesting about relationships.
Many romantic relationships actually begin between people who already know each other.
According to surveys cited by relationship researchers, a large percentage of couples report meeting through:
-
mutual friends
-
school or work connections
-
social networks
Because Facebook already connects billions of users worldwide, adding a feature that allows hidden mutual interest made sense.
Instead of forcing people to approach someone directly, Secret Crush allows attraction to reveal itself naturally.

Mistake #1: Adding People Who Don’t Use Facebook Dating
One of the most common misunderstandings involves how the system works.
Secret Crush only works if the other person is actively using Facebook Dating.
If someone never created a dating profile, your selection will never lead to a match.
For example:
Imagine selecting a coworker from your Facebook friends list who rarely uses Facebook.
Even if they like you in real life, they cannot match with you unless they are also using the dating feature.
How to Avoid This Problem
Before adding someone as a Secret Crush, ask yourself:
-
Are they active on Facebook?
-
Do they seem open to dating apps?
-
Are they in your age group that typically uses online dating?
You will increase your chances by choosing people who are more likely to use Facebook Dating.
Mistake #2: Choosing People Outside Your Dating Range
Your Facebook Dating settings include filters such as:
-
age range
-
location
-
gender preferences
If your Secret Crush falls outside these settings, the system may not work the way you expect.
For example:
A 24-year-old user who sets a dating range of 22–30 may not match with someone who is 35, even if they add them to Secret Crush.
Quick Fix
Make sure your dating preferences align with the people you select.
Sometimes a small adjustment to your age or distance settings can make a difference.

Step 4: Be Patient
One overlooked aspect of Secret Crush is timing.
Someone may add you as a crush weeks or months after you select them.
This happens when they eventually discover the feature or update their dating profile.
Avoid checking the app obsessively.
Let the system work naturally.

Frequently Asked Questions About Facebook Dating Secret Crush
How many people can I add to Secret Crush?
You can add up to nine people to your Secret Crush list at one time.
Will someone know I added them as a crush?
No. They only receive a notification if they also add you to their list.
Can Secret Crush work with Instagram?
Yes. If your accounts are linked, you can add people from your Instagram followers list.
What happens if there is a match?
Both users receive a notification revealing that they added each other as a Secret Crush.
Can I remove someone from my crush list?
Yes. You can remove or replace people from the list at any time.
